Permanent Full-Time (1.0 FTE) Primary Care Nurse Practitioner
Peaks to Prairies Primary Care Network (PCN) is a physician-led non-profit corporation that works collaboratively with Alberta Health Services and our community partners to support primary care in Olds, Sundre and surrounding area. Our mission is to be a health home where we provide patient-focused care, support, and resources to enable our patients to achieve their best health.
Are you a Nurse Practitioner who meets the competency requirements and standards for working at full scope of practice? If so, we invite you to apply for this opportunity to join our PCN! The position will be a Permanent 1.0 FTE and will be located at the Moose & Squirrel Medical Clinic in Sundre.
As a member of an interprofessional team in the patient medical home, the Nurse Practitioner will work collaboratively with physicians and team members to provide high quality, evidence-based primary health care to an assigned patient population of all ages. There will be a primary focus on patients with complex chronic health concerns.
Our ideal candidate has:
- Demonstrated experience in successfully working as part of an interdisciplinary team to provide patient and family-centered care in the patient medical home.
- Previous Nurse Practitioner experience in primary health care setting.
- Advanced organizational, prioritization and panel management skills.
- The ability to take initiative and be a self-starter and self-learner.
- Decision making, strategic and critical thinking skills.
- Strong relationship building skills with the team, patients, and their families.
- Previous experience in using electronic medical records.
- A Master of Nursing with a Family Nurse Practitioner focus.
- Current registration with CARNA.
